Description: Invicta DC Comics Harley Quinn Watch (model 27058), 48mm black steel chronograph with a red carbon-fiber tachymeter bezel, black-and-red dial split by playing-card diamond and club suit symbols with two chronograph sub-dials and a small jester-masked Harley Quinn portrait at 6 o'clock, black steel bracelet; product photograph on white background.
